How to choose a violin

Families in Zephyrhills should think about size, setup, sound, and practice goals before renting or buying a violin. Fractional-size violins help younger students play with healthy posture, while full-size violins should still include a usable bow, case, rosin, shoulder rest, and tuner. Before making a purchase after checking Music and Arts and Themusichouse.Com,, compare size, tone, peg function, bridge setup, bow condition, shoulder rest fit, and the true value of any bundle. If the price seems unusually low, ask about setup history, open seams, cracks, peg function, bow condition, and whether the violin holds tuning. Books and violin materials

Violin materials in Zephyrhills lessons should support the student's age, level, instrument size, musical taste, teacher assignment, and long-term direction. Some students use Suzuki Violin School, Essential Elements for Strings, Sound Innovations for String Orchestra, or All for Strings, while others need etudes, scale books, sight-reading, fingering notes, or favorite-piece sheet music. The basic setup is a tuned violin, bow, rosin, shoulder rest, reliable internet, a device with a camera, and a quiet lesson space. Many beginners start with a rental violin, especially when the student is still growing through fractional sizes, with rhythm, tone, and musical goals staying connected.

Renting can reduce upgrade pressure for growing students, while buying requires more attention to size, bow, rosin, shoulder rest, case, maintenance, and budget. If Music and Arts is convenient, ask practical questions about size, setup, and maintenance without assuming one model fits everyone, while the student builds confidence one assignment at a time.

Many students begin violin between ages 6 and 8, though readiness is more important than age alone. Hand size, finger strength, coordination, attention span, musical interest, and simple direction-following all matter, with enough detail for focused weekly practice, so progress feels steady between lessons.
